One Instanton Predictions of a Seiberg-Witten curve from M-theory: the Symmetric Representation of SU(N)

Isabel P. Ennes, Stephen G. Naculich, Henric Rhedin, Howard J. Schnitzer

hep-tharXiv:hep-th/9804151

Abstract

We consider N=2 supersymmetric Yang-Mills theories in four dimensions with gauge group SU(N) for N larger than two. Using the cubic curve for a matter hypermultiplet transforming in the symmetric representation, obtained from M-theory by Landsteiner and Lopez, we calculate the prepotential up to the one instanton correction. We treat the curve to be approximately hyperelliptic and perform a perturbation expansion for the Seiberg-Witten differential to get the one instanton contribution. We find that it reproduces the correct result for one-loop, and we obtain the prediction for that curve for the one instanton correction term.
